Mine Index 3652   P. J. Dowiatt and Sons Coal Company,   Dowiatt No. 1 Mine

County: Vermilion
Quadrangle: Danville SE
County Coal Data: Vermilion
Shown On Map: Yes
Unlocated: No
MSHA ID:

Mine Index Number: 3652

Company Name: P. J. Dowiatt and Sons Coal Company
Mine Name: Dowiatt No. 1 Mine
Start Date: 1926 End Date: 1938
Type of Mine: Underground
Total acres shown: 21
Acres after map date: General Area of mining acres shown:

Shaft, Slope, Drift or Tipple Location(s)

Type County Township-Range Section Part Section
Main slope Vermilion 18N 11W 3 SE NE SW
Air shaft Vermilion 18N 11W 3 NE SE SW

Geology

Thickness (ft)
Seam Depth (ft) Min Max Ave Mining Method
Herrin 100 6.33-6.67 RPB

Geological Problems Reported

The source map showed a sink hole (probably subsidence) on the northwest side of the mine.

Production

Company Mine Name Date Production (tons)
OBrien and Kyger OBrien and Kyger 1926-1927 14,860
H. P. Kyger Kyger 1928-1928 7,067
P. J. Dowiatt and Sons Coal Company Dowiatt No. 1 1929-1938 84,903
Total Production: 106,830
